A faulty thermostat can trick your furnace into staying off, even when heat is needed. We test thermostat wiring, battery function, and sensor readings to confirm it's working or recommend a replacement.
Many older Glendale homes have outdated mechanical thermostats that lose accuracy over time. We upgrade to modern units that offer better control and efficiency.
A dead pilot light is one of the simplest no-heat problems—and one of the quickest to fix. We safely relight pilot lights, check flame sensors, and inspect ignition components to ensure reliable starts.
If your pilot light keeps going out or your furnace won't ignite, the thermocouple may be worn or the igniter may be failing. We diagnose which part needs attention and replace it so your heat stays on.

If your furnace runs but no warm air moves through the house, the blower motor may be stuck, dirty, or failing. We clean blower wheels, check motor bearings, inspect belts and filters, and replace parts to restore airflow.
Blocked return vents or clogged filters often create the same symptom. We clear obstructions and verify ductwork is open and unobstructed so heated air reaches every room.

Check your thermostat first. Make sure it's set to heat mode and the temperature setting is higher than the current room temperature. If the thermostat battery is dead or display is blank, replace the battery or reset it. If heat still doesn't come on, inspect your return air vents to ensure they're not blocked by furniture or dust, and replace your furnace filter if it looks clogged. If those steps don't restore heat, call an HVAC technician to diagnose the furnace itself.
